FDAGX Mutual Fund Overview

FDAGX Mutual Fund (Fidelity Select Consumer Staples Fund Class A) is managed by Fidelity Investments (US) with $245.2M in net assets. FDAGX expense ratio is 0.97%, holding 47 positions across sectors including Consumer Staples, Consumer Discretionary, Unknown. Inception date: 2006-12-12.

FDAGX performance shows a YTD return of 10.64%. The 1-year return is 10.19% and the 5-year return is 4.22%. FDAGX dividend yield stands at 1.55%, paid quarterly.

FDAGX top holdings include The Coca-Cola Company (13.5%), Procter & Gamble Co/The Pg Us Equity (10.6%), Costco Whsl (9.0%), Walmart Inc Com USD0.1 (7.8%), Keurig Dr Pepper Inc. (7.3%). View all FDAGX holdings, sector breakdown, or dividend history.
